Whales are those big players holding large quantities of a cryptocurrency, and their transactions can sway market prices. Typically, these investors are early adopters, institutions, or wealthy individuals looking to make a mark.
Lately, the SHIB community has seen a notable surge in whale transactions, with multiple transfers exceeding $25 million in value. This kind of activity often stirs up speculation about potential price shifts, and it’s something you should definitely keep an eye on.
Whale movements can create significant swings in market sentiment. When whales are buying, it often leads to bullish trends, while selling can trigger bearish responses among retail traders like you. It’s a dance you’ll want to watch closely.
In the last six months, SHIB has danced between a price range of $0.000006 to $0.000016, reflecting a pump of approximately 166%. Understanding this history offers valuable context for your current trading decisions.
Currently, SHIB is trading around $0.000013, having recently bounced off a significant support level at $0.000011. Price charts suggest buying momentum is building up in the last few days, which you might find promising.
Whales often engage in accumulation during bullish phases, gradually purchasing assets to drive prices up. On the flip side, during distribution phases, they may sell off their holdings, which can cause price drops that you’ll want to be prepared for.
